I had driven by Cedar Center Hardware many times but never went in. The water line to my refrigerator sprung a leak, and I had to replace it. In the process, I managed to mangle the brass fittings that connected on the fridge end, trying to separate them from each other and the old tubing. I called Frigidaire to see if I could order replacement parts. It wasn’t even certain that the parts they were quoting were the parts I needed. One was $.78 cents. The other $ 25! I was about to head to Home Depot to see if I could locate these small plumbing parts, but I sensed that would be a fiasco. I knew I would probably never find them on my own, and finding a knowledgeable(or any) employee to help seemed about as futile, based on past experience. I decided to give Cedar Center Hardware a try. What a great decision! Not one, but two people(the owner Lenny and based on their website I believe the store manager Ken, if it was someone else I apologize) helped me right away! They quickly diagnosed what parts I needed, and found them in their bins. They took the time to show me how everything should go together. They were friendly and helpful the whole time. All of that great customer service, and my total cost was $.84 cents! I felt guilty, paying so little for such awesome service and help. I was so impressed with the great service they provided for such a small sale. The parts worked beautifully, and the ice maker and water dispenser on my fridge are back up and running. While they didn’t make much profit on that sale, they won a repeat customer for life. I will use them for all of my future hardware needs, and highly recommend anyone else do so as well!
